Are there pre-made kits available for building a log house playhouse?

Yes, some companies offer pre-cut log house playhouse kits. These kits usually include all the necessary logs, hardware, and detailed instructions, simplifying the construction process. The benefit is less cutting and measuring on your end.

What skills are needed to build a log house playhouse from scratch?

Basic carpentry skills like measuring, cutting, and fastening are helpful. Familiarity with power tools (saw, drill) and an understanding of basic construction techniques are also beneficial for building a log house playhouse from scratch using the DIY guide.

How much does it typically cost to build a log house playhouse?

The cost varies greatly depending on the size, materials used, and whether you’re building from scratch or using a kit. A DIY log house playhouse can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ars. Kits tend to be more expensive upfront.
